Deborah Abela (born 13 October 1966 in Sydney) is an Australian author of children's books, most notably the Max Remy, Super Spy series, Grimsdon and Teresa A New Australian. She has been writing for 15 years.

Awards

2017 KOALA Legend (Kids Own Literature Awards)

2017, 2012, 2011 Grimsdon Shortlisted for YABBA and KOALA awards

2017 Teresa A New Australian Shortlisted for WAYRBA Awards (Western Australian Young Readers Book Awards)

2017 Teresa A New Australian Best Book in Translation, Malta Book Awards

2017 The Stupendously Spectacular Spelling Bee shortlisted for the Australian Family Therapists Awards

2015 Ghost Club series shortlisted for KOALA, YABBA, CROC awards

2015 New City shortlisted for the KOALA, YABBA, CROC awards

2013 Ghost Club series shortlisted for Sisters In Crime Davitt Awards

2013 Maurice Saxby Award for Services to Children's Literature

2012 The Remarkable Secret of Aurelie Bonhoffen shortlisted Outstanding International Book Award USBBY

2011 Grimsdon awarded Most Enthralling Junior Fiction Award

2011 Grimsdon shortlisted Aurealis Awards

2011 Grimsdon shortlisted Speech Pathology Awards

2010 The Remarkable Secret of Aurelia Bonhoffen, was shortlisted for best children's book in the 2010, and was awarded "Notable Book of 2010" by the Children's Book Council of Australia.

2010 The Remarkable Secret of Aurelie Bonhoffen shortlisted for the Aurealis Awards

2010, 2007, 2005 Max Remy Superspy voted best series KOALA and YABBA awards

2008 Max Remy Superspy Angus and Robertson's Top 50 books

2007 Max Remy Superspy shortlisted USA Children's Choice Awards and WAYRBA awards

In 2008, She was awarded the May Gibbs Fellowship for Children's Literature.

Awarded the 2006 Oppenheim Toy Portfolio Gold Seal Best Book Award.
